Ive been having electrical problems for about 4-5 months. I cant even drive my car. Right now i dont have dsmlink on my car cus i burned the ecu, (still havent fixed it). Put back my 97 stock ecu and MAFT to 880 cc and all that.

I installed a new alternator and two new batteries.
This is the problem....

When I put the ign switch on, My apex TT volt meter reads 11.4~11.6v

I start the car...

Horrible idle, can even keep my engine running alone at idle. I have to rev it.

After the car is on the meter reads 10.2 ~ 10.3v

If i hit the accel pedal WOT the rcar reach a max rpm of 3500rpm ~ 5000rpm and the car makes crazy sounds like poping sounds, like a pop corn machine inside the Intake manifold, i even hear it from the turbo intake pipe, looks like im going to break the engine

If the car is over 3.5K rpm the volts are over 13.2v to 13.4v

If i release the the pedal the car lose volts and the engine stops.

Theres no short between the battery in the trunk to the fuse box. New battery, New Alt dont know what to do.
 
I'm thinking it sounds like a short of some type, if your voltage's are becoming unstable along with the popcorn noise, maybe try thinking about your timing, almost like you have a sensor short making the timing to become retard or advanced. I'm not the expert on this but sharing my insight.

I changed my spark plugs, spark plug cables, Coils, and tested a friends power transitor, still have the problem.

I stripped the engine harness the best i could under the hood, cable by cable if there was a broken or bad cable and everything looked good. I tried to do it under the dash but it is very dificult,

is there a better way how to find a short?

Just get a multimeter, put it on ohms,plug one cable into the beginning of the wire and the other cable in the end of the wire, if it zeros out then you have a solid connection, but ony after the shake test, once multimeter is connected to beginning and end of wire just shake the lead around anywhere you can grab it to make sure, once done that, turn the key on and do it again.
 
Ok man, here`s what happened to me on my 2G, ONLY after an ecu swap(95 eprom w/custom chip) . . .

Swapped in the eprom ecu, car ran like crap, & sometimes would not start at all. I assumed that it was a bad ecu or chip(the car ran perfect before the swap).

After 3 ecu`s, 2 chips, & 2 months of testing components(mas,ignition transistor,tps,etc.), The problem was a bad main ecu & sensor ground, behind the dash, where the black ground wires break out of the main ecu harness, & bolt down to a metal lug with a 10 mm. nut on the metal inner dashboard support.

What happened was, the 4 or 5 ground wires terminate at a ring terminal, which is bolted to the dash frame for a gound, The FACTORY crimp was bad, & by disturbing it (swapping the ecu, & jostling the ecu harness wiring),the weak crimp failed, leaving the ecu & all sensors with no or limited ground paths.

This drove me freaking nuts for weeks, until I started tracing wires & found it.
